Transaction 2e00802abea5d4b7ec62a1495099ee2a8cb28a3096b1ec12cedeed74b73b19c3

1 Input
1 Outputs
  • 2e00802abea5d4b7ec62a1495099ee2a8cb28a3096b1ec12cedeed74b73b19c3:0
  • value  2509843357
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Y